- the present invention relates to a rotating bracket suitable for engagement with corresponding fixed parts of cabinets, in particular refrigerator cabinets, and with parts of a shelf, for ensuring locking in position of the latter.
- refrigerator cabinets and freezer cabinets are equipped with different types of shelves such as: ordinary shelves, refrigeration evaporator shelves and trays on/inside which the products to be cooled are placed.
- Said evaporator shelves are normally supported on the sides and on the rear side, opposite to the door of the cabinet, by means of intermittent or continuous brackets which are formed by means of moulding on the sides of the cabinet at the time when the cooling compartment is made.
- brackets which are known in the art, are engaged, at their free ends, with removable, auxiliary, locking elements which are designed to keep said shelves in position and/or prevent the trays arranged underneath the said shelves from being extracted and falling when they are opened in order to take out the contents.
- locking elements are, for example, known from EP 0,534,107 which describes a U-shaped element able to be inserted, by means of a rectilinear translatory movement, onto the correspondingly shaped free end of the said brackets which are integral with the wall of the refrigerator cabinet.
- Said U-shaped element also has a pin extending towards the wall of the cooling compartment and able to be inserted into a corresponding hole when the element reaches the end of its travel path.
- said locking elements which are known in the art, nevertheless have drawbacks arising from the fact that the sliding movement of the U-shaped element is controlled by incisions formed on the fixed guide of the cabinet wall, which makes manual assembly difficult, also because, before its insertion into the associated end-of-travel hole, the said pin is subject to a forcing action, when sliding along the wall, and this may cause scoring of the latter, resulting moreover in an inclined position of the U element with respect to the guide, thereby making the insertion operation difficult owing to the misalignment between the two parts during relative displacement.
- the pin tends to come out from its seat owing to the deformation which may affect the surface when it is subject to the vertical load caused by the weight of the objects placed thereon.
- the technical problem which is posed is therefore that of providing a supporting/locking element for shelves of cabinets and in particular evaporator elements of refrigerator cabinets, which solves the abovementioned problems of the known art.
- a refrigerator apparatus 10 has, on its side walls 11, guides 12 which project towards the inside of the refrigerator compartment and which extend parallel to the wall 11 along predefined sections, so as to form surfaces for retaining and/or sliding of evaporator elements 20 provided with an associated stiffening cross-piece 21, and/or trays 30.
- said guides 12 have at their free ends directed towards the door 10a of the cabinet (for the sake of convenience always called “front part” below) a longitudinal extension 13 formed at the time of moulding of the cooling compartment; said longitudinal extension 13 has a vertical dimension which is smaller than that of the longitudinal guide 12 (Fig. 7) and is suitable for engagement with a bracket 40, according to the present invention, described below.
- the end of the guide 12 adjacent to the extension 13 also has safety elements respectively consisting of a shaped seat 12a extending in the longitudinal direction on the upper surface of the guide 12 and delimited towards the inside of the refrigerator by an inclined side 12b.
- said safety elements are designed to interact with the bracket 40 so as to prevent the movement thereof in the various directions; in particular, the seat 12a is able to form an end-of-travel stop for rotation of the bracket in the direction of its locking into the working position; the side 12b is in turn designed to form a safety locking system in the transverse direction for preventing movement of the bracket away from the wall.
- the bottom surface 13a of the extension 13 forms moreover an additional safety element able to prevent rotation of the bracket in the unlocking direction.
- a seat 14 is also formed thereon, said seat being able to receive a corresponding pin 41 of the bracket 40 according to the present invention.
- Said seat 14 is shaped so as to have at least two opposite sides 14a which are parallel and straight and at least two opposite sides 14b with a rounded concave shape.

- an inclined surface 44 which forms the end-of-travel stop for the tray 30 situated underneath; it is also pointed out that, since said stop is positioned below the axis of rotation of the pin 41, it is able to act in the direction of screwing and therefore stable locking of the bracket 40, should the tray be forced in the extraction direction; likewise the evaporator element 20 or equivalent surface acts in the direction of tightening of the bracket when it is subject to a high axial load resulting from the weight of the objects positioned thereon.
- the bracket according to the invention solves the problems of the known art, allowing easy manual assembly as a result of precision insertion of the pin in the associated seat and secure fastening of the bracket to the wall of the refrigerator which opposes the unlocking movements and slackening movements in a transverse direction away from the said wall owing to the various elements for relative fastening of the bracket, the wall guide and the end extension of the said guide.
- the mating cam-like profile of the pin 41 and the associated seat may for example be formed with different profiles and relative orientations, provided that the two fundamental positions for insertion/extraction and locking/unlocking are maintained.
